其中,VMware作为虚拟化领域的领头羊,以其强大的功能、高度的灵活性和卓越的性能,赢得了全球众多企业和开发者的青睐
本文将深入探讨如何安装与配置VMware虚拟机,旨在为读者提供一份详尽、实用的操作指南,帮助大家轻松驾驭这一强大工具
一、VMware虚拟机简介 VMware(Virtual Machine Ware)虚拟机软件允许用户在一台物理计算机上运行多个操作系统实例,每个实例都作为一个独立的虚拟机(VM)存在
这种技术极大地提高了资源利用率,降低了硬件成本,同时方便了系统测试、软件开发、灾难恢复等多种应用场景
VMware Workstation、VMware Fusion(针对Mac)、VMware ESXi(服务器级虚拟化平台)等产品广泛应用于个人、企业及数据中心环境
二、安装前的准备工作 2.1 硬件要求 - 处理器:支持虚拟化技术(如Intel VT-x或AMD-V)的CPU
- 内存:至少4GB RAM,建议8GB或以上以获得更佳性能
- 存储空间:根据计划运行的虚拟机数量和操作系统大小,预留足够的磁盘空间
- 操作系统:Windows、Linux等支持VMware安装的主机操作系统
2.2 软件下载 访问VMware官方网站,根据操作系统类型(Windows/Linux/Mac)下载对应版本的VMware Workstation/Fusion安装包
确保下载的是最新版本,以获得最新的功能和安全补丁
三、安装VMware虚拟机软件 3.1 安装过程 1.双击安装包启动安装向导,按照提示接受许可协议
2. 选择安装路径,可保持默认设置或自定义安装目录
3. 根据需要选择是否安装VMware Tools(增强虚拟机与宿主机之间的交互性能)
4. 完成安装后,重启计算机以确保所有组件正确加载
3.2 激活软件 安装完成后,启动VMware软件,输入购买时获得的许可证密钥进行激活
合法授权不仅能享受完整功能,还能获得官方技术支持和服务
四、创建并配置虚拟机 4.1 新建虚拟机 1.打开VMware软件,点击“创建新的虚拟机”
2.选择典型或自定义安装
典型安装适用于大多数场景,自定义安装则允许更细致的配置
3.安装来源:选择“安装程序光盘映像文件”(ISO文件),或通过物理光驱安装
4.操作系统选择:根据需求选择合适的操作系统类型和版本
5.命名虚拟机并指定安装位置
6.配置磁盘大小:可选择立即分配全部磁盘空间或根据需要动态增长
4.2 虚拟机硬件配置 - CPU:根据实际需求分配CPU核心数,注意不要超过宿主机物理CPU核心数的一半,以免影响宿主机性能
- 内存:合理分配内存大小,确保宿主机和虚拟机都能流畅运行
- 网络适配器:选择NAT模式、桥接模式或仅主机模式,根据网络连接需求决定
- SCSI控制器:默认设置通常足够,但对于高性能需求可考虑调整
- CD/DVD驱动器:连接到ISO文件或物理驱动器,用于操作系统安装
USB控制器:启用以支持USB设备直通
五、安装操作系统 5.1 启动虚拟机 配置完成后,点击“开启此虚拟机”
虚拟机将启动并进入BIOS/UEFI设置界面(部分虚拟机可能直接跳过)
5.2 安装操作系统 - 选择启动设备:通常从CD/DVD驱动器启动,加载操作系统安装介质
- 按照屏幕提示完成操作系统安装过程,包括语言选择、时区设置、用户账户创建等
- 安装VMware Tools:在操作系统安装完成后,通过VMware菜单安装VMware Tools,这将大幅提升虚拟机性能,如全屏显示、鼠标无缝切换、共享文件夹等功能
六、高级配置与优化 6.1 共享文件夹 - 在VMware设置中,配置共享文件夹,允许虚拟机与宿主机之间文件共享,便于数据传输
6.2 快照管理 - 利用快照功能,可以在特定时刻保存虚拟机状态,便于系统恢复或测试不同配置而不影响原始环境
6.3 性能调优 - 根据虚拟机运行的应用负载,调整CPU、内存分配,以及启用或禁用不必要的硬件模拟
- 使用VMware的资源监控工具,定期检查虚拟机和宿主机的资源使用情况,进行相应调整
七、安全与维护 7.1 安全策略 - 定期更新虚拟机内的操作系统和应用程序,安装防病毒软件,确保系统安全
- 限制虚拟机网络访问权限,避免潜在的安全风险
7.2 数据备份 - 实施定期备份策略,包括虚拟机文件和快照,以防数据丢失
八、结语 通过本文的详细指导,相信读者已经掌握了VMware虚拟机的安装配置方法,以及如何进行基本和高级的管理与优化
VMware虚拟机不仅极大地提高了工作效率和资源利用率,还为软件开发、系统测试、教育演示等提供了无限可能
随着技术的不断进步,VMware将继续引领虚拟化领域的发展,为企业和个人用户带来更多创新与价值
让我们携手探索虚拟化的广阔天地,共同迈向更加智能、高效的计算未来